On Monday 22nd of March we did a play called The Wizard of Oz. It was brilliant fun. I was a Yellow Brick Road Dancer. We had to practise a lot. We had to look out at the audience all the time.
Mrs Egan taught us all the songs. Miss Shanahan looked after backstage and did the prompting. Mr Gleeson wrote the whole play and the words to one of our songs and he played the part of the Wizard.
There were nine scenes in the whole play. We started rehearsing for the play near the end of January.
Some people made their costumes, others borrowed from other people and some even made their costumes.
The Wizard was very funny. The Wizard's Apprentice was too but the Scarecrow was the funniest of them all.
There was a raffle at the end and my daddy won third prize.
I loved the play and we raised a lot of money.
